WitrynaDespite decades of high vaccination coverage, pertussis has remained endemic and reemerged as a public health problem in many countries in the past 2 decades. Waning of vaccine-induced immunity has been cited as one of the reasons for the observed epidemiologic trend. Witryna4 mar 2024 · Some possible side effects of a whooping cough vaccine include: 3. Fever. Pain, redness, or swelling at the injection site. Headache. Feeling tired. Upset stomach, diarrhea, or vomiting. Fussiness (in kids) Loss of appetite. These symptoms are usually mild and will subside in a few days.
